..
dialog_about
Remove unused version info
2016-09-04 19:14:26 -04:00
dialogs
Explicitly mark overriding functions.
2016-09-24 14:53:15 -04:00
gal
update font code along with the changes done in the msdf atlas tool (use codepoint spans and refined char placement)
2016-10-20 14:31:09 +02:00
geometry
SHAPE_POLY_SET: mark all newly added hole outlines as closed
2016-10-19 17:54:00 +02:00
kicad_curl
Narrow assumption on OpenSSL use
2016-05-28 13:11:24 -04:00
math
Remove superflous includes.
2015-07-31 09:50:47 -04:00
page_layout
Fixes: lp:1629387 (pagelayout text sometimes shrinking)
2016-10-06 17:19:55 +02:00
swig
Cleanup SWIG's board.i, remove scrap *.{ref,orig} files, and add .pyc to .gitignore
2016-09-23 08:04:12 -04:00
tool
Split the undo/redo event into the two stages "pre" and "post" for convenient synchronization of dependent state.
2016-09-23 13:29:25 +02:00
view
VIEW_GROUP objects redraw itself after a change
2016-09-12 11:50:06 +02:00
widgets
Removed deprecated pragmas to mute warnings
2016-09-26 14:53:43 +02:00
CMakeLists.txt
Make footprint ID into a generic library ID.
2016-11-20 18:35:08 -05:00
base_screen.cpp
Make undo/redo limits user configurable.
2015-08-05 10:28:27 -04:00
base_struct.cpp
common: remove dependency on libbitmaps in EDA_ITEM::GetMenuImage()
2016-10-19 17:54:00 +02:00
base_units.cpp
Remove code since minimum wxwidgets version is 3.0.0.
2016-07-10 23:10:03 -04:00
basic_gal.cpp
Rework on class EDA_TEXT and related classes and draw text functions. More work: remove useless or duplicate code (from legacy graphic text plot functions). Move basic_gal code to separate files.
2016-03-25 09:26:11 +01:00
basicframe.cpp
Add Help Menu item to open browser at kicad-pcb.org/contribute
2016-10-10 19:01:45 -04:00
bezier_curves.cpp
Add missing source file licenses and code policy fixes.
2014-10-19 16:20:16 -04:00
bin_mod.cpp
Remove old, empty header
2016-01-12 10:35:27 -05:00
bitmap.cpp
Remove old xpm icons files
2012-04-07 13:09:57 +02:00
block_commande.cpp
Fic bug #1475891 (Assertion failed when appending a board in pcbnew)
2015-07-19 11:18:07 +02:00
build_version.cpp
Minor version string generation improvements.
2016-10-12 20:29:46 -04:00
class_bitmap_base.cpp
Eeschema: Fix off-by-one in saving bitmaps
2016-11-09 09:46:35 +01:00
class_colors_design_settings.cpp
Add missing source file licenses and code policy fixes.
2014-10-19 16:20:16 -04:00
class_layer_box_selector.cpp
Move the non shared file class_sch_screen.h to eeschema folder. Code cleaning. Remove some wxCHECK_VERSION tests now useless.
2015-07-29 20:06:45 +02:00
class_marker_base.cpp
Plot solder mask layer: fix incorrect margin of zones drawn on this layer (zone areas were slighly larger than the actual areas)
2015-08-01 12:20:23 +02:00
class_page_info.cpp
Fix Bug #1536427 ("User (Custom)" size selection in"Page Settings" issue in non English languages).
2016-01-21 11:15:13 +01:00
class_plotter.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
class_undoredo_container.cpp
Unified undo buffer handling code for PCB & module editor.
2016-09-12 11:50:06 +02:00
colors.cpp
Try to fix a compil issue on OSX (no viable conversion from 'const wxString' to 'const wxChar *', in colors.cpp)
2016-05-17 09:10:15 +02:00
commit.cpp
Fixed a crash when removing zones using the Global Deletion dialog
2016-10-20 17:15:50 +02:00
common.cpp
Use std::atomic for portable locale init counting
2016-05-28 12:46:22 -04:00
common_plotDXF_functions.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
common_plotGERBER_functions.cpp
Fix a minor issue when creating net attributes in Gerber files for oval pads when they are not horizontal or vertical .
2016-09-25 10:55:24 +02:00
common_plotHPGL_functions.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
common_plotPDF_functions.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
common_plotPS_functions.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
common_plotSVG_functions.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
common_plot_functions.cpp
Plot PS and PDF: fix bug Bug #1457215 (rect/trap pads plotted with an incorrect pen size, and therefore an incorrect size and shape. Only noticeable with a large default pen size)
2015-05-21 11:04:47 +02:00
config_params.cpp
Replace BOOST_FOREACH with C++11 range based for.
2016-06-29 16:07:55 -04:00
confirm.cpp
Explicitly mark overriding functions.
2016-09-24 14:53:15 -04:00
convert_basic_shapes_to_polygon.cpp
Gerbview: Fix 2 (minor) issues in aperture macro "moire". Add a .gbr test file for this aperture macro.
2016-10-13 10:26:49 +02:00
copy_to_clipboard.cpp
Enable plot in clipboard on Linux and OSX in eeschema, and copy in clipboard in 3d viewer ( was existing on Windows, but disabled on other OS ).
2015-05-31 13:51:50 +02:00
dialog_shim.cpp
more about dlg size fixes and osx fixes
2016-07-14 19:30:25 +02:00
displlst.cpp
Replace dangerous cast of pointer->long
2016-01-16 22:56:58 -05:00
dlist.cpp
Hide m_galCanvas and m_galCanvasActive behind accessors. Fix DLIST concatonation API corner case.
2013-12-26 16:36:43 -06:00
draw_frame.cpp
Remove legacy option to zoom to selection on middle mouse button
2016-06-11 19:37:43 -04:00
draw_panel.cpp
Fix issue: When left-clicking on the "window frame" (blue top area on Windows) (Any editor), the window jumps to bottom half of the screen, if a context menu is currently opened (could be Windows specific)
2016-08-05 16:10:45 +02:00
draw_panel_gal.cpp
Removed wxPaintDC from EDA_DRAW_PANEL_GAL::onPaint()
2016-09-19 15:17:18 +02:00
drawtxt.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
dsnlexer.cpp
coverity common folder fixes (mainly not initialized members).
2015-03-11 17:04:20 +01:00
eda_dde.cpp
Fix a few shadowed local vars, and coding style issues.
2016-04-22 12:44:08 +02:00
eda_doc.cpp
2 very minor fixes in Eeschema:
2015-11-14 09:20:17 +01:00
eda_pattern_match.cpp
Eeschema: add wildcard and regular expression search to componet select dialog.
2015-12-20 15:52:39 -05:00
eda_text.cpp
Switched to default constructor and operator= for EDA_TEXT.
2016-09-12 11:50:06 +02:00
exceptions.cpp
Split IO_ERROR out of richio.* and store Problem() and Where() separately
2016-09-20 11:56:18 -04:00
filter_reader.cpp
Add Pcbnew GEDA PCB module plugin support.
2012-12-28 15:52:12 -05:00
findkicadhelppath.cpp.notused
improve help file finding after kiway breakage.
2014-04-14 13:49:52 -05:00
footprint_info.cpp
Make footprint ID into a generic library ID.
2016-11-20 18:35:08 -05:00
fp_lib_table.cpp
Make footprint ID into a generic library ID.
2016-11-20 18:35:08 -05:00
gbr_metadata.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
gestfich.cpp
Removed the space in the error message after the new line
2016-01-05 06:12:37 +13:00
getrunningmicrosecs.cpp
Fix very minor issues: compil warnings (mainly deprecated and shadowed vars warnings).
2016-05-22 19:39:20 +02:00
gl_context_mgr.cpp
Reverted 6912 with minor changes (LockCtx requires to specify canvas that locks a context).
2016-06-13 16:43:33 +02:00
gr_basic.cpp
Fixed a crash when GRLineArray is called with an empty vector.
2016-05-26 17:14:08 +02:00
grid_tricks.cpp
Add missing C++ stdlib headers
2016-05-28 12:46:29 -04:00
hotkeys_basic.cpp
Move hotkey list from Preferences menu to Help menu
2016-06-11 21:22:13 -04:00
html_messagebox.cpp
Fix graphics rendering on RTL systems (lp:1559545)
2016-03-22 14:53:50 -04:00
kiface_i.cpp
OSX build improvements.
2014-10-02 19:03:52 -04:00
kiway.cpp
SWIG Improvements
2016-09-20 11:59:43 -04:00
kiway_express.cpp
Teach cvpcb about new KIWAY based cross-probing, factor out MAIL_T into mail_type.h
2014-04-22 10:16:19 -05:00
kiway_holder.cpp
License for KIWAY_HOLDER
2016-08-11 14:41:15 +02:00
kiway_player.cpp
Dismiss warning for inconsistent exception spec in ~KIWAY_PLAYER()
2016-09-30 22:32:24 -04:00
lib_id.cpp
Make footprint ID into a generic library ID.
2016-11-20 18:35:08 -05:00
lib_table.keywords
Make footprint ID into a generic library ID.
2016-11-20 18:35:08 -05:00
lib_table_base.cpp
Make footprint ID into a generic library ID.
2016-11-20 18:35:08 -05:00
lockfile.cpp
Use XDG_CONFIG_DIR for lock file path on Linux.
2015-01-07 10:04:57 -05:00
lset.cpp
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
msgpanel.cpp
Fix some issues related to the footprint wizard frame:
2015-09-07 12:52:16 +02:00
netlist.keywords
Fix Bug #1381287 (CvPCB ignores the footprint filter field on aliased components)
2015-01-02 08:52:29 +01:00
newstroke_font.cpp
all: new Russian GOST patch - author Konstantin Baranovskiy
2013-03-28 00:38:20 +04:00
origin_viewitem.cpp
Add axis origin to the Footprint Editor to align with the Legacy canvas
2015-09-05 20:47:35 +01:00
painter.cpp
Fixed a few memory leaks and Valgrind warnings.
2014-07-09 15:02:56 +02:00
pcb.keywords
pcbnew: added diff pair gap & width to Design Rules dialog & PCB file format.
2016-08-15 17:16:49 +02:00
pcb_plot_params.keywords
Prepare Plot Gerber file to include advanced aperture and net attributes.
2016-09-19 13:01:36 +02:00
pcbcommon.cpp
3D Viewer: complete refactor of the 3D viewer.
2016-07-19 13:35:25 -04:00
pgm_base.cpp
SWIG Improvements
2016-09-20 11:59:43 -04:00
prependpath.cpp
Fix some issues related to the footprint wizard frame:
2015-09-07 12:52:16 +02:00
project.cpp
Fix very minor issues: compil warnings (mainly deprecated and shadowed vars warnings).
2016-05-22 19:39:20 +02:00
properties.cpp
Eeschema: initial schematic I/O plugin.
2016-07-06 05:22:56 -04:00
ptree.cpp
Eeschema: extend max number of units per package to 52 and clean code to easily extend this value upto 26x26 (but 52 is a reasonable max value).
2015-04-07 13:52:29 +02:00
reporter.cpp
Added lazy rendering mode for HTML reporter widget (allows a faster report creation, when the report has many lines)
2015-07-24 17:47:48 +02:00
richio.cpp
Split IO_ERROR out of richio.* and store Problem() and Where() separately
2016-09-20 11:56:18 -04:00
search_stack.cpp
Fix windows help path bug. (fixes lp:1313412)
2015-09-20 14:23:17 -04:00
searchhelpfilefullpath.cpp
Fix windows help path bug. (fixes lp:1313412)
2015-09-20 14:23:17 -04:00
selcolor.cpp
Add missing C++ stdlib headers
2016-05-28 12:46:29 -04:00
single_top.cpp
Add more "override" markers.
2016-09-25 13:59:41 -04:00
string.cpp
Pcbnew: Fpid parser: Fix crash when reading a .kicad_pcb file containing a valid fpid with a revision value.
2015-08-23 14:35:49 +02:00
strtok_r.c
Add strtok_r.c
2013-12-10 17:52:51 -06:00
systemdirsappend.cpp
Minor fixes: remove a few useless includes and move a few others to the right file. Remove a few coverity warnings about not initialized members.
2015-05-15 14:49:11 +02:00
trigo.cpp
Clarify atan2 overloads
2016-01-17 10:59:24 -05:00
utf8.cpp
Initial KIWAY (modular-kicad) work. Various tweeks.
2014-02-03 09:10:37 -06:00
validators.cpp
Envrionment variable dialog improvments.
2015-08-16 20:30:29 -04:00
wildcards_and_files_ext.cpp
Pcbnew: remove dead macro code.
2016-04-18 11:03:59 -04:00
worksheet.cpp
Add %L formatter to worksheets to print layer name.
2016-09-10 14:23:59 -04:00
worksheet_viewitem.cpp
Replace BOOST_FOREACH with C++11 range based for.
2016-06-29 16:07:55 -04:00
wx_status_popup.cpp
Code formatting.
2015-02-18 17:53:46 +01:00
wx_unit_binder.cpp
Fix some issues related to the footprint wizard frame:
2015-09-07 12:52:16 +02:00
wxunittext.cpp
Code cleanup: Remove outdated decimils to/from iu defines and conversion functions (decimils are no more in use since a long time).
2016-06-05 13:49:25 +02:00
wxwineda.cpp
* KIWAY Milestone A): Make major modules into DLL/DSOs.
2014-03-19 19:42:08 -05:00
xnode.cpp
Make KiCad compile with minimal warnings against SVN HEAD of wxWidgets as of today.
2014-01-07 19:34:04 -06:00
zoom.cpp
Allows switching GAL or legacy mode in footprint editor (previously, the mode was inherited from the board editor, and was not modifiable without closing the footprint editor) by menu or F9, F11 and F12 keys)
2015-05-19 18:39:05 +02:00